How they compare

Nepal currently reports 41.47 Mt CO2e against 40.62 Mt CO2e in Cameroon, a difference of 0.85 Mt CO2e.

The two have swapped places 4 times across 55 shared years of data; in 1970 it was Nepal ahead.

Cameroon ranks 92nd and Nepal ranks 89th of 203 countries.

Across the 6 decades both report, Cameroon averaged higher in 2 and Nepal in 4.

Head to head by decade

Decade Cameroon Nepal Difference Ahead
1970s 8.91 Mt CO2e 17.46 Mt CO2e 8.55 Mt CO2e Nepal
1980s 25.24 Mt CO2e 21.35 Mt CO2e 3.89 Mt CO2e Cameroon
1990s 28.38 Mt CO2e 25.43 Mt CO2e 2.95 Mt CO2e Cameroon
2000s 30.31 Mt CO2e 30.32 Mt CO2e 0.0022 Mt CO2e Nepal
2010s 35.22 Mt CO2e 40.44 Mt CO2e 5.23 Mt CO2e Nepal
2020s 40.15 Mt CO2e 46.44 Mt CO2e 6.29 Mt CO2e Nepal

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

A measure of annual emissions of the six greenhouse gases (GHG) covered by the Kyoto Protocol (carbon dioxide (CO2), methane (CH4), nitrous oxide (N2O), hydrofluorocarbons (HFCs), perfluorocarbons (PFCs), and sulphurhexafluoride (SF6)) from the energy, industry, waste, and agriculture sectors, standardized to carbon dioxide equivalent values. This measure excludes GHG fluxes caused by Land Use Land Use Change and Forestry (LULUCF), as these fluxes have larger uncertainties. The measure is standardized to carbon dioxide equivalent values using the Global Warming Potential (GWP) factors of IPCC's 5th Assessment Report (AR5).
